  4. Has anyone made any progress with this? My father has access to this stuff for GM, Ford and Chry products, but not yet for the Porsche. I also have a 2008 Silverado that he reprogramed the PCM and it made huge differences! They have dyno results that show 65 HP gains along with 2-3 mpg gains on the 6.0L GM! Increadible gains for the price (about 350 bucks) and completely programable for different octane, tire, tranny... I have been looking for something along these lines for the Cayenne, but to no avail....
